MasTec Advanced Technologies Construction Manager in Austin, Texas

Overview

Company Summary

MasTec Utility Services delivers critical infrastructure construction and engineering services for power delivery, gas, and water customers, specializing in overhead and underground electric distribution for power delivery systems, gas distribution construction for gas systems, and turnkey solutions for a variety of water, sewer, and civil infrastructure projects. Backed by the strength of eight decades of experience, exceptional industry skills, and a deep commitment to our core values, we continually strive to innovate, uplevel our abilities, and provide extraordinary value to our clients.

MasTec Utility Services Company is a subsidiary of MasTec, a certified Minority-Controlled Company by the National Minority Supplier Development Council (NMSDC).

Job Summary

The Construction Manager provides management and direction of utility construction activities. Project work includes project management, resource allocation, equipment management, and utility construction. Duties performed are associated with human resources, payroll, accounting, and administrative functions. This position supports the Construction team and works with field personnel, senior operations management, and customers.

Responsibilities

  • Manage all projects to completion on-time and within budget.

  • Schedule the crews, identify and delegate the crews to start their work, review project timelines and expectations, and supervise work performance and job quality.

  • Participate in the hiring process and maintain all employment related paperwork (i.e. new hire paperwork, separation paperwork, employment data changes, etc.).

  • Promote a safe work environment, holding crews accountable to safe work practices.

  • Determine job costs, labor, and material needed, ensuring on-time deliveries.

  • Prepare and interpret drawings, graphs, maps, blueprints, bid documents, contracts, proposals, and specifications.

  • Identify and resolve any blueprint issues prior to and during construction.

  • Identify and supervise subcontractors to perform their tasks, inspect, and/or bill any relevant personnel/contractors.

  • Take responsibility for all personnel and any vehicles or equipment in their control.

  • Participate in meetings with senior operations management, peers, and/or customers.

  • Participate in estimating and bidding projects, contract negotiations, and change order preparation.

Qualifications

  • Associate degree in Construction Management or Engineering.

  • 5 years of relevant Construction Manager experience.

  • 2 years in a supervisory position.

  • OSHA 30 Certification.

Preferred

  • Bachelor's degree in Construction Management or Engineering.

  • 10 years of relevant experience.
